Infrabase.ai — The AI Infrastructure Directory is a comprehensive directory that helps developers discover, compare, and evaluate AI infrastructure tools and services across the AI stack. It catalogs products and platforms that enable building, deploying, and operating AI-powered applications, spanning from foundational data and model infrastructure to observability, analytics, and specialized tooling. The platform emphasizes breadth of categories, ease of discovery, and access to a variety of open source and commercial options to accelerate AI product development.

Product Categories
- Vector Databases (e.g., Zilliz)
- Prompt Engineering (e.g., Prompt Mixer, Klu, Giskard)
- Observability & Analytics (e.g., Comet, Honeyhive, Pezzo)
- Inference APIs (e.g., Synexa, fal, novita.ai)
- Frameworks & Stacks (e.g., LlamaIndex, Haystack, Modular)
- Fine-tuning (e.g., Monster API, Modal, Replicate)
- Audio (e.g., Deepgram, Resemble AI, Eleven Labs)
- Agents (e.g., CrewAI, AgentOps, Dendrite)
